Hail damage is often invisible from the ground. Signs include dented or cracked shingles, granule loss in gutters, dented flashing or vents, and circular marks on soft metals. We provide free hail damage inspections with detailed photo documentation.
Yes. For Alton homeowners in hail-prone areas, we recommend Class 4 impact-resistant shingles that are tested to withstand 2-inch hailstones. These premium shingles also qualify for insurance discounts in many Illinois policies.
Hail as small as 1 inch in diameter (quarter-sized) can damage asphalt shingles. Larger hailstones cause increasingly severe damage including cracked tiles, dented metal, and broken skylights. Even if hail seemed small, an inspection is recommended.
Most hail damage is invisible from ground level. Granule loss, hairline cracks, and compromised seals require close-up inspection. That is why Roof Angels offers free professional roof inspections after hailstorms in Alton — our trained crew spots what you cannot.
